Zydus Wellness’ skincare brand, everyuth® naturals, has expanded its portfolio with the launch of Tan Removal Chocolate & Cherry Face Wash, as it looks to strengthen its presence in India’s facewash category.
The launch comes amid evolving skincare preferences, particularly among Gen Z and younger millennials, who are increasingly moving towards benefit-led and results-driven routines. The brand aims to position daily cleansing as a more functional and efficacy-driven step within skincare.
The product has been clinically tested across Indian skin types and is designed to reduce tan and improve skin radiance with regular use. According to the company, the formulation combines antioxidant properties of chocolate with Vitamin C-rich cherry extracts and is positioned to deliver visible results from the first use.
The launch builds on the brand’s existing Tan Removal range, including scrub and face pack offerings, and extends the proposition into a daily-use format. The communication is anchored around the message ‘Ab Roz Tan Ghatega’, highlighting a focus on consistent, everyday results.

The launch is supported by an integrated campaign, including a television commercial featuring actors Tisca Chopra and Kashmira Pardeshi. The film depicts a conversation between a mother and daughter around sun exposure, using a contemporary tone to reflect changing attitudes towards skincare among younger consumers.
The product is available across retail outlets and e-commerce platforms in India.
